Denbigh borough was founded after 1282 and received town rights in 1290. During this period, the construction of the town walls and the castle was initiated on the initiative of King Edward I and Henry de Lacy, Earl of Lincoln. The main north-eastern section with the Countess Tower was completed around 1290 ...
WebDenbigh castle was built by Henry de Lacy, Earl of Lincoln as part of a borough-town foundation under license from King Edward Ist. Begun in 1282, it is likely that the first phase, which enclosed the southern and western sides of the castle and continued to define the boundary of the associated town, was complete by 1294.
